Rufai emerges Kwara APC candidate for Patigi rerun

Date: 2020-02-14

Ahmed Adam Rufai has emerged as the All Progressives Congress (APC)'s candidate for the March 14 House of Assemblu rerun ballot in Patigi local government area of Kwara State.

Rufai was affirmed as the APC candidate by 4587 party chieftains and members at an affirmation exercise conducted on Friday by a six-person committee from the national headquarters of the ruling party in Abuja.

His nomination/affirmation, which involved party members from across the 10 wards in the local government, was announced by the committee led by AbdulAzeez Anuhi.

Anuhi commended the party leaders, elders, members and the security agencies as well as INEC officials for the peaceful conduct of the exercise.

He appealed to the people of Patigi to turn out en masse to vote for APC during the March 14 bye-election.

The rerun ballot is coming a few months after the death of Hon. Ahmed Rufai who represented the Patigi Constituency at the House of Assembly.

Commissioner for local government and chieftaincy affairs Aisha Ahman Patigi said the APC administration has been doing a lot to turn around the fortune of the state and assured the people of the area that the upcoming Social Investment Programme of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q was designed to combat unemployment and extreme poverty.

Special Adviser to the Governor on Political Matters Saadu Salahu also highlighted the laudable achievements of the Governor which included Patigi township road, Patigi water works, school rehabilitation projects, Kpada and Gada road works, and the collaborative efforts with neighbouring states that culminated in the award of contract of Pata Etsugi bridge connecting Kwara and Niger States.

Vice Chairman of APC in Kwara North Sunday Oyebiyi commended the party leaders and members for their discipline and massive turn out in the last elections.

Other members of the six-man national electoral committee were Ohalete Wisdom Chinedu (Secretary); Yahaya Dahiru; Habu Kalba Usman; Bashir Adamu Othman; and Shettima Muhammad.

The exercise was witnessed by officials of APC in the State including Deputy Chairman Abdullahi Samari; the State Secretary Muhammad Mustapha Salman; ViceChairman (Kwara North) Sunday Oyebiyi; and the State Organising Secretary Samuel Isa.

The 6-man national electoral committee had earlier disqualified the second aspirant Dr Mahmud Kpotun in the primaries for a number of irregularities in his nomination process at the end of the screening exercise.
